I've had a bad back since 1994. I had a great chiropractor in New York who kept the pain in check and I saw him once a month. When I hurt it again last April, I went to the guy in Colony. He ran a vibrating device up and down my back, which didn't help. He scheduled me for 3 visits a week for 6 weeks. His office drew up a payment plan which would have cost over $2,000. I didn't sign up for the plan (Which there was an additional $600 for a nutritional consultation). I went the first week with the vibrating device, and he showed me on his computer how much my back was doing. The only problem was the pain was still there and didn't feel any better. I stopped going after the 3 visits in the first week. Fortunately we headed back to New York and I got myself straightened out. We moved here full time in October, so I wanted a Chiropractor I could trust here. We found Daniel Taylor at Compton Chiropractic. He is a Palmer graduate, which our NY guy suggested and he does hands-on manipulation. I explained what my NY guy did and what I wanted. He was great. One visit, and the next one is next month. My wife and I are very happy with him. Hope this helps.....
